Jumpin' Regionals

The day dawned early (way too early).

At 4am, B was telling me that she was excited and nervous for the jump rope competition that day. I told her she wasn't going to have to worry about being nervous if she didn't go back to sleep because she would be asleep during her routines!

The Regional competition is held in April and the top 4 in each category get to continue on to Nationals in Galveston, Texas at the end of June. B made it last year and was really (REALLY) hoping to make it again. She moved up into the 11 and 12 year old group this year, so that really put the pressure on.

She was ready, though!

I had to be a judge for the afternoon during the freestyle, so I couldn't take any good action shots of the kids being upside down, or doing a back handspring or doing a tush up. (I'm sorry, did you just ask what is a tush up? It's when you are sitting on the floor with your legs straight out in front of you and you swing the rope around horizontally and "jump" over the rope with your butt. Yeah, that's right. Who knew your butt has springs? Mine doesn't.)
